Grasping Thermostatic Shower Valves: A Comprehensive Guide

Thermostatic shower valves provide precise temperature control, promising a uniform showering experience. These valves utilize a system that adjusts to fluctuations in water pressure and flow, holding the desired temperature despite external changes. Putting in a thermostatic shower valve can enhance your bathroom comfort.

  • Furthermore, they help to prevent scalding incidents, ensuring them a reliable choice for households with children.
  • Choosing the suitable thermostatic shower valve depends on your particular needs. Consider factors such as water pressure, desired flow rate, and accessible space.

Troubleshooting Common Thermostatic Shower Valve Problems

A thermostatic shower valve can bring luxury to your daily routine, but like any plumbing fixture, it can sometimes experience problems. Detecting the root cause of these issues is the first step towards a swift and effective repair. One common problem is fluctuating water temperature, which could be attributed to a faulty thermostat cartridge or mineral buildup inside the valve. If your shower water suddenly turns ice-cold, it's more info likely that the hot water supply has been interrupted. This may suggest a problem with your boiler or water heater, however a leaking shower valve could lead to water damage and reduced pressure.

Regular maintenance can help prevent many thermostatic shower valve problems. Confirm that you regularly clean the valve's filter to remove any mineral deposits, and check for leaks around the handle and spout. If you encounter persistent issues, you should always contacting a qualified plumber for professional assistance.
